Supabase Update
Update rows in a Supabase table
PATCHes rows via Supabase REST using a required PostgREST filter. Always requests Prefer: return=representation; select defaults to * to return all columns. Requires an API key with write access to the table.
type: io.kestra.plugin.supabase.UpdateExamples
Update records with a simple filter.
id: supabase_update_simple
namespace: company.team
tasks:
- id: update_user_status
type: io.kestra.plugin.supabase.Update
url: https://your-project.supabase.com
apiKey: "{{ secret('SUPABASE_API_KEY') }}"
table: users
data:
status: "inactive"
updated_at: "{{ now() }}"
filter: "id=eq.123"
Update multiple records with complex filtering.
id: supabase_update_multiple
namespace: company.team
tasks:
- id: update_inactive_users
type: io.kestra.plugin.supabase.Update
url: https://your-project.supabase.com
apiKey: "{{ secret('SUPABASE_API_KEY') }}"
table: users
data:
status: "archived"
archived_at: "{{ now() }}"
filter: "status=eq.inactive&last_login=lt.2023-01-01"
Update with return of specific columns.
id: supabase_update_with_return
namespace: company.team
tasks:
- id: update_user_email
type: io.kestra.plugin.supabase.Update
url: https://your-project.supabase.com
apiKey: "{{ secret('SUPABASE_API_KEY') }}"
table: users
data:
email: "newemail@example.com"
email_verified: false
filter: "id=eq.123"
select: "id,email,email_verified,updated_at"
Properties
apiKey *Requiredstring
Supabase API key
API key sent in Authorization and apikey headers; use service_role for writes and elevated policies, anon key is limited.
data *Requiredobject
Row values to apply
Map of column names to values sent as JSON after rendering expressions.
filter *Requiredstring
PostgREST filter
Required filter expression (e.g., id=eq.123) that scopes which rows are updated; broad filters can modify many rows.
table *Requiredstring
Target table name
Supabase table to patch; value is rendered before the request.
url *Requiredstring
Supabase project URL
Base project URL (e.g., https://your-project.supabase.com); the REST path /rest/v1 is appended automatically.

pluginDefaultsRef Non-dynamicstring
Reference (ref) of the pluginDefaults to apply to this task.
schema string
publicDatabase schema
Postgres schema for the request; defaults to public and adds Accept-Profile/Content-Profile headers when set.
select string
Columns returned
Comma-separated columns to include in the response; defaults to *.
Outputs
code integer
HTTP status code
headers object
Response headers
rawResponse string
Raw response body
updatedCount integer
Number of rows updated
updatedRows array
Updated rows returned
uri string
uriExecuted request URI
